北语19春《数据库应用(SQL server)》作业1234满分答案

合集下载
  1. 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
  2. 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
  3. 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。

19春《数据库应用(SQLserver)》作业1
下列哪种数据类型上不能建立Identity列。

A.int
B.tinyint
C.float
D.smallint
正确答案:C
为数据表创建索引的目的是()。

A.提高查询的检索性能
B.创建唯一索引
C.创建主键
D.归类
正确答案:A
下列哪一种备份方式只备份了自上次备份操作发生后重新发生改变的数据()。

A.全数据库备份
B.增量备份
C.日志备份
D.文件和文件组备份
正确答案:B
以下关于外键和相应的主键之间的关系,正确的是()。

A.外键并不一定要与相应的主键同名
B.外键一定要与相应的主键同名
C.外键一定要与相应的主键同名而且唯一
D.外键一定要与相应的主键同名,但并不一定唯一
正确答案:A
选择要执行操作数据库,应该是哪个SQL命令()。

E
B.GO
C.EXEC
D.DB
正确答案:A
定单表Orders的列OrderID的类型是小整型(smallint),根据业务的发展需要改为整型(integer),应该使用下面的哪条语句()。

A.ALTERCOLUMNOrderIDintegerFROMOrders
B.ALTERTABLEOrders(OrderIDinteger)
C.ALTERTABLEOrdersALTERCOLUMNOrderIDinteger
D.ALTERCOLUMNOrders.OrderIDinteger
正确答案:C
下列哪个不是数据库对象()。

A.数据模型
B.视图
C.表
D.用户
正确答案:A
SQL语言中,条件“年龄BETWEEN40AND50”表示年龄在40至50之间,且()。

A.包括40岁和50岁
B.不包括40岁和50岁
C.包括40岁但不包括50岁
D.包括50岁但不包括40岁
正确答案:A
下列哪类数据不适合创建索引()。

A.经常被查询搜索的列,如经常在Where子句中出现的列
B.是外键或主键的列
C.包含太多重复选用值的列
D.在ORDERBY子句中使用的列
正确答案:C
下列四项中说法不正确的是()。

A.数据库减少了数据冗余
B.数据库中的数据可以共享
C.数据库避免了一切数据的重复
D.数据库具有较高的数据独立性
正确答案:C
在SQLSERVER2000安装过程中,下列哪个因素与安装成功与否没有关系()。

A.用户是否正在修改清册表
B.用户是否正在运行IIS
C.用户是否正在启动旧版本的SQLSERVER
D.用户的Windows2000是否打了足够多的补丁
正确答案:D
以下SQL语句功能是()。

Selectcourse..课程名,course.学时数fromcoursewherecourse.学时数100
A.显示所有课程的课程名
B.显示所有课程的课程名和学时数
C.显示所有学时数大于100的课程名
D.显示所有学时数大于100的课程名和学时数
正确答案:D
在表中创建一个标识列(IDENTITY),当用户向表中插入新的数据行时,系统会自动为该行标识列赋值。

A.错误
B.正确
正确答案:B
"11.9"是SQL中的实型常量。

A.错误
B.正确
正确答案:A
DELETE语句只是删除表中的数据,表本身依然存在数据库中。

A.错误
B.正确
正确答案:B
在SQLServer系统中,数据信息和日志信息不能放在同一个操作系统文件中。

A.错误
B.正确
正确答案:B
创建触发器的时候可以不是表的所有者或数据库的所有者。

A.错误
B.正确
正确答案:A
使用视图可以降低程序对底层表的信赖性。

A.错误
B.正确
正确答案:B
数据库一旦建立就不允许修改大小。

A.错误
B.正确
正确答案:A
bigint是SQL的数据类型。

A.错误
B.正确
正确答案:B
19春《数据库应用(SQLserver)》作业2
在通常情况下,下列哪个事物不是数据库对象()。

A.View
B.Table
C.Rule
D.Word
正确答案:D
下列哪个不是sql数据库文件的后缀。

A..mdf
B..ldf
C..dbf
D..ndf
正确答案:C
SQL语言中,条件“年龄BETWEEN40AND50”表示年龄在40至50之间,且()。

A.包括40岁和50岁
B.不包括40岁和50岁
C.包括40岁但不包括50岁
D.包括50岁但不包括40岁
正确答案:A
SQLServer系统中的所有服务器级系统信息存储于哪个数据库()。

A.master
B.model
C.tempdb
D.msdb
正确答案:A
在数据库设计中使用E-R图工具的阶段是()。

A.需求分析阶段
B.数据库物理设计阶段
C.数据库实施
D.概念结构设计阶段
正确答案:D
为数据表创建索引的目的是()。

A.提高查询的检索性能
B.创建唯一索引
C.创建主键
D.归类
正确答案:A
以下关于外键和相应的主键之间的关系,正确的是()。

A.外键并不一定要与相应的主键同名
B.外键一定要与相应的主键同名
C.外键一定要与相应的主键同名而且唯一
D.外键一定要与相应的主键同名,但并不一定唯一
正确答案:A
在通常情况下,下列哪个角色的用户不能够删除视图。

A.ad_owner
B.db_ddladmin
C.sysadmin
D.guest
正确答案:D
选择要执行操作数据库,应该是哪个SQL命令()。

E
B.GO
C.EXEC
D.DB
正确答案:A
你正在使用SQLServer2000开发超市收银系统。

在客户端编写软件时使用SQL语句“SELECT*FROMProducts”来查询商品的信息,但是不小心把Products输入成Product。

请问该错误在哪一层被发现()。

A.客户端的数据库API
B.客户端的NET-LIBRARY
C.服务器端的开放式数据服务
D.服务器端的关系引擎
正确答案:D
下列哪个数据库是可以在运行SQLSERVER过程中被删掉的()。

A.master
B.model
C.pubs
D.northwind
正确答案:C
定单表Orders的列OrderID的类型是小整型(smallint),根据业务的发展需要改为整型(integer),应该使用下面的哪条语句()。

A.ALTERCOLUMNOrderIDintegerFROMOrders
B.ALTERTABLEOrders(OrderIDinteger)
C.ALTERTABLEOrdersALTERCOLUMNOrderIDinteger
D.ALTERCOLUMNOrders.OrderIDinteger
正确答案:C
设置惟一约束的列可以为空。

A.错误
B.正确
正确答案:B
外键的值绝对不允许为NULL。

A.错误
B.正确
正确答案:B
使用视图可以降低程序对底层表的信赖性。

A.错误
B.正确
正确答案:B
每一个服务器必须属于一个服务器组。

一个服务器组可以包含0个、一个或多个服务器。

A.错误
B.正确
正确答案:B
执行INSERT操作时候,如果表格中存在定义为NOTNULL的数据列,那么该列的值必须要出
现VALUES的列表中。

A.错误
B.正确
正确答案:B
SQLSERVER所有操作都将记录在日志里。

A.错误
B.正确
正确答案:A
在表中创建一个标识列(IDENTITY),当用户向表中插入新的数据行时,系统会自动为该行标识列赋值。

A.错误
B.正确
正确答案:B
语句select22%4,的执行结果是:0。

A.错误
B.正确
正确答案:A
19春《数据库应用(SQLserver)》作业3
下列哪个数据库是SQLSERVER在创建数据库时候,可以使用的模板。

A.master
B.model
C.pubs
D.msdb
正确答案:B
在SQL语言中,"授权"命令是()。

A.GRANT
B.REVOKE
C.OPTION
D.PUBLIC
正确答案:A
下列哪个关键字在select语句中表示所有列()。

A.*
B.ALL
C.DESC
D.DISTINCT
正确答案:A
如果执行带有联接运算的查询,并且联接的列已排序,那么SQL Server用什么联接策略效率最好()。

A.哈希联接
B.合并联接
C.交叉联接
D.嵌套迭代
正确答案:B
你正在使用SQLServer2000开发超市收银系统。

在客户端编写软件时使用SQL语句“SELECT*FROMProducts”来查询商品的信息,但是不小心把Products输入成Product。

请问该错误在哪一层被发现()。

A.客户端的数据库API
B.客户端的NET-LIBRARY
C.服务器端的开放式数据服务
D.服务器端的关系引擎
正确答案:D
你正在使用SQLServer2000开发银行交易系统,为了保证商业数据在网络传输(用TCP/IP协议)时不会被窃取,你在SQLServer2000中启用了网络加密功能。

请问该功能在哪一层被实现()。

A.TCP/IP协议软件
B.超级套接字层
C.开放式数据服务
D.关系引擎
正确答案:B
以下SQL语句功能是()。

Selectcourse..课程名,course.学时数fromcoursewherecourse.学时数100
A.显示所有课程的课程名
B.显示所有课程的课程名和学时数
C.显示所有学时数大于100的课程名
D.显示所有学时数大于100的课程名和学时数
正确答案:D
在数据库设计中使用E-R图工具的阶段是()。

A.需求分析阶段
B.数据库物理设计阶段
C.数据库实施
D.概念结构设计阶段
正确答案:D
以下关于主键的描述正确的是()。

A.标识表中唯一的实体
B.创建唯一的索引,允许空值
C.只允许以表中第一字段建立
D.表中允许有多个主键
正确答案:A
下列哪一种备份方式只备份了自上次备份操作发生后重新发生改变的数据()。

A.全数据库备份
B.增量备份
C.日志备份
D.文件和文件组备份
正确答案:B
在SQLSERVER服务器上,存储过程是一组预先定义并()的Transact-SQL语句。

A.保存
B.编译
C.解释
D.编写
正确答案:B
选择要执行操作数据库,应该是哪个SQL命令()。

E
B.GO
C.EXEC
D.DB
正确答案:A
SQLSERVER只能使用Windows的系统认证机制。

A.错误
B.正确
正确答案:A
由于truncatetable操作不进行日志的记录,所以删除数据后无法恢复。

A.错误
B.正确
正确答案:B
"11.9"是SQL中的实型常量。

A.错误
B.正确
正确答案:A
视图本身没有保存数据,而是保存一条查询语句。

A.错误
B.正确
正确答案:B
客户端应用程序与数据库服务器必须位于同一台计算机上。

A.错误
B.正确
正确答案:A
数据库一旦建立就不允许修改大小。

A.错误
B.正确
正确答案:A
在SQLServer系统中,数据信息和日志信息不能放在同一个操作系统文件中。

A.错误
B.正确
正确答案:B
为了减少管理的开销,在对象级安全管理上应该在大多数场合赋予数据库用户以广泛的权限。

A.错误
B.正确
正确答案:B
19春《数据库应用(SQLserver)》作业4
你正在使用SQLServer2000开发银行交易系统,为了保证商业数据在网络传输(用TCP/IP协议)时不会被窃取,你在SQLServer2000中启用了网络加密功能。

请问该功能在哪一层被实现()。

A.TCP/IP协议软件
B.超级套接字层
C.开放式数据服务
D.关系引擎
正确答案:B
下列查询类型中,会改变数据源的是()。

A.参数查询
B.交叉查询
C.操作查询
D.选择查询
正确答案:C
选择要执行操作数据库,应该是哪个SQL命令()。

E
B.GO
C.EXEC
D.DB
正确答案:A
在学生成绩表tblCourseScore中的列Score用来存放某学生学习某课程的考试成绩(0~100分,没有小数),用下面的哪种类型最节省空间()。

A.int
B.smallint
C.tinyint
D.decimal(3,0)
正确答案:C
SQLServer系统中的所有服务器级系统信息存储于哪个数据库()。

A.master
B.model
C.tempdb
D.msdb
正确答案:A
在SQLSERVER服务器上,存储过程是一组预先定义并()的Transact-SQL语句。

A.保存
B.编译
C.解释
D.编写
正确答案:B
在登记学生成绩时要保证列Score的值在0到100之间,下面的方法中哪种最简单()。

A.编写一个存储过程,管理插入和检查数值,不允许直接插入
B.生成用户自定义类型type_Score和规则,将规则与数据类型type_Score相关联,然后设置列Score的数据类型类型为type_Score
C.编写一个触发器来检查Score的值,如果不在0和100之间,则撤消插入
D.在Score列增加检查限制
正确答案:D
下列哪个不是sql数据库文件的后缀()。

A..mdf
B..ldf
C..tif
D..ndf
正确答案:C
公司中有多个部门和多名职员,每个职员只能属于一个部门,一个部门可以有多名职员,从部门到职员的联系类型是()
A.多对多
B.一对一
C.多对一
D.一对多
正确答案:D
SQL语言中,删除记录的命令是()。

A.DELETE
B.DROP
C.CLEAR
D.REMOVE
正确答案:A
SQL语言中,条件年龄BETWEEN15AND35表示年龄在15至35之间,且()。

A.包括15岁和35岁
B.不包括15岁和35岁
C.包括15岁但不包括35岁
D.包括35岁但不包括15岁
正确答案:A
定单表Orders的列OrderID的类型是小整型(smallint),根据业务的发展需要改为整型(integer),应该使用下面的哪条语句()。

A.ALTERCOLUMNOrderIDintegerFROMOrders
B.ALTERTABLEOrders(OrderIDinteger)
C.ALTERTABLEOrdersALTERCOLUMNOrderIDinteger
D.ALTERCOLUMNOrders.OrderIDinteger
正确答案:C
使用视图可以降低程序对底层表的信赖性。

A.错误
B.正确
正确答案:B
创建触发器的时候可以不是表的所有者或数据库的所有者。

A.错误
B.正确
正确答案:A
每一个服务器必须属于一个服务器组。

一个服务器组可以包含0个、一个或多个服务器。

A.错误
B.正确
正确答案:B
删除表是必须小心注意的操作,因为表一旦删除便无法恢复。

A.错误
B.正确
正确答案:B
"xingming"是SQL中的字符串常量。

A.错误
B.正确
正确答案:A
为了减少管理的开销,在对象级安全管理上应该在大多数场合赋予数据库用户以广泛的权限。

A.错误
B.正确
正确答案:B
SQLSERVER只能使用Windows的系统认证机制。

A.错误
B.正确
正确答案:A
数据库一旦建立就不允许修改大小。

A.错误
B.正确
正确答案:A。

相关文档
最新文档